Output 624ba75ce85ae39c490ad238f067d1bbe0ab3dd43bdc26a9f1e1876a19f18344:0

value
271462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ab13cf8b309470998b4802c0feab85c59acd22c3 OP_EQUAL
address
3HHbCpVD5DeJyvXxkXYDP2jDHtwDFuDYBg
transaction
624ba75ce85ae39c490ad238f067d1bbe0ab3dd43bdc26a9f1e1876a19f18344
spent
true